Block walls serve both practical and aesthetic purposes in landscaping, providing structure, privacy, and visual interest to outdoor areas. These walls can be utilized to retain soil on sloped homes, define garden beds, or create clear borders within a landscape. The choice of block type-- concrete, interlocking, or decorative-- impacts both the strength and look of the wall. Correct planning makes sure stability, particularly for taller walls, with factors to consider for drain, reinforcement, and soil pressure. Installation begins with a well-prepared base, typically involving excavation and leveling to guarantee the wall stays straight and stable with time. Mortar or adhesive might be utilized depending upon the block type, and reinforcement like rebar can enhance sturdiness. A competent landscaper makes sure each course is level and aligned, avoiding future shifting or cracking. Block walls also offer innovative opportunities through finishes, textures, and colors, permitting them to match the surrounding landscape. Incorporating lighting, planters, or cascading plants can soften the tough edges, making the wall both useful and aesthetically attractive. Regular inspections and minor repairs help preserve the wall's integrity for years to come
